Description | | Description:
Technical assistance will be provided to new administrators, teachers and
leadership team members at schools implementing a Multi-Tier System of Supports
(MTSS). Participants will review the critical components of the MTSS with a
brief presentation of an overview of the areas in which the district has
developed written plans with a focus on the continuous improvement process and
systematic decision making based on data and research-based practices for
instruction (core and intervention); assessment system; decision rules to
identify student needs and effectiveness of instruction; professional
development and coaching supports; process for decision making for instruction,
assessment, professional development; and, review of the district’s plan for
how a leadership will ensure support for focused implementation of the MTSS.
